Worked on my chip shots today. I’ve gotten reasonably good at chipping from fairway or short-rough greenside lies on level ground. So I mixed it up with some downhill lies and deep rough lies. The downhill lies need a little oomph taken off the stroke, as they play longer than a level lie. When chipping [...]
